Picking the Right Clock Mechanism
The clock mechanism is the most important part. You can find these online or at craft stores. Here's what to keep in mind:
- Size: Choose a size that works with your design and the space.
- Type: Quartz mechanisms are cheap and reliable.
- Hands: Pick hands that match the style and size of your clock face.
- Features: Some have a second hand or are super quiet.

Tools You'll Need
Before you start, gather these tools. It makes the whole process much easier:
- Measuring Tape & Ruler: Accurate measurements are key!
- Pencil: For drawing your design.
- Scissors or Craft Knife: For cutting your materials.
- Drill: To make holes for the clock mechanism and hands.
- Sandpaper: To smooth any rough edges.
- Hot Glue Gun: To stick things together securely.
- Screwdrivers: For the clock mechanism.
- Paint, Markers, etc.: To decorate your clock face.
- Clock Hands & Mechanism: Don't forget these!
Let's Make a Clock! Step-by-Step
Follow these steps to build your own unique clock:
- Prepare Your Clock Face: Cut your material to the right size and shape. Sand the edges if needed.
- Mark the Center: Find the exact center. This is super important!
- Drill the Center Hole: Carefully drill a hole for the clock mechanism.
- Decorate!: Get creative and personalize your clock face.
- Attach the Mechanism: Securely attach it to the back, making sure it's centered.
- Attach the Hands: Carefully attach the hour, minute, and second hands (if you have them).
- Battery Time: Put in the battery.
- Test It Out: Set the time and make sure it works.
- Hang It Up: Attach a hanger to the back and hang your clock!
